What kind of belongings are safeguarded? The regulations define “relevant premises” as “premises used for residential purposes under a license. A fixed-term rental agreement, or a lease,” and the requirements extend. To appliances and flues provided for tenants’ use in “associated premises.” Any contract lasting less than seven years is protected. What precisely am I responsible for now that I’m ready to become a landlord? Insist on the safe condition of all gas appliances and ventilation systems. When performing maintenance on gas appliances, it is best to follow the manufacturer’s instructions wherever possible. If you don’t have access to these, you should get them serviced at least once a year. Or whenever a Gas Safe trained engineer recommends it. You must have a Gas Safe registered engineer perform all installation, maintenance, and safety checks. Keep a record of each safety check for at least two years; and issue a certificate of compliance for all appliances within one year of the lease start date unless. The appliances in the property have been installed for less than 12 months. In which case they should be checked within 12 months of the installation date (in certain cases there is an option to display the record). Which gas appliances are protected? Except for appliances owned by the tenant, flues/chimneys solely connected to an appliance owned by the tenant. And appliances and flues serving the “relevant premises. (such as central heating boilers not installed in tenants’ accommodation but used to heat them). Any gas appliance or flue installed in the “relevant premises” is subject to the safety check and maintenance requirements. Any gas equipment (for example, gas fires supplied to clients in non-residential areas of public establishments). Used solely in a non-residential component of the premises is exempt from the safety check. You are responsible for executing routine maintenance and safety checks on both permanent. And temporary goods, such as LPG cabinet heaters. Is it possible to delegate tasks to a tenant? No, save that a landlord and tenant may sign an agreement addressing a business appliance. Or flue in a non-residential portion of the building. Your tenant must refrain from using any appliance they consider harmful. So, what happens if I employ a manager? The landlord is still responsible for ensuring that all regulations are obeyed. The management agreement should clearly state who is responsible for scheduling and documenting routine maintenance and safety inspections. What if the property is sublet?” is the question In such circumstances, the “original” landlord may retain duties similar to those assumed by the sublessee. Also, tenants’ rights and the property owner’s legal obligation to safeguard them must be prioritized and clearly defined in such instances. How can I carry out the essential procedure to gain access to a building? The contract conditions you arrange with the tenant should cover your maintenance and safety checks. You must use “all reasonable methods” to do this, including serving a formal notice. On a renter requesting access and explaining why you require it. Keep precise records of everything you’ve done if a renter refuses entrance. And you must prove that you’ve taken the essential procedures. Also, tenants who persistently refuse requests for admission may face legal action under the lease’s conditions. However, do not try to force your way in. I need to hire a gas engineer, but I need to figure out who to trust The engineer should have a current ID card on hand. The card includes a portrait of the engineer, the company name. The card’s issue and expiration dates, and a hologram for enhanced security. Also, back of the card lists the engineer’s gas specializations. Keep duplicates of any repairs you make to address. Issues discovered during the safety inspection in case they are needed later. It is criminal to use or permit the use of harmful gas equipment. Any equipment that has been unplugged or isolated for safety reasons should only be restored once the problem has been resolved.
